Indications for L.R.S. OF-Garches T-Clamp

In Woodworking

  • For furniture making, the L.R.S. OF-Garches T-Clamp is used when assembling frames. When constructing a wooden table, it can hold the table legs and rails in place while glue dries and screws are inserted. The T-shape provides extra stability, preventing the pieces from shifting. It’s also useful for clamping wooden boards during planing or routing to ensure a smooth and even surface.
  • In cabinetry, it helps hold cabinet sides together for gluing and nailing. Whether it’s a base cabinet or a wall-mounted cabinet, the clamp’s strong grip and T-design make it easy to achieve square and accurate joints. It can also be used to hold decorative moldings in place for attachment.

In Metalworking

  • When fabricating metal structures, it’s used to hold beams and angles in position for welding. For example, when building a metal staircase, the T-Clamp can secure the steps and stringers until the welds are complete. It provides the necessary force to keep the metal pieces in alignment, reducing the risk of misalignment and weak welds.
  • In sheet metal work, it can clamp sheets during bending or cutting operations. It helps maintain the shape and position of the sheet metal, allowing for more precise bends and cuts. It’s also useful for holding small metal parts during drilling or grinding, ensuring safety and accuracy.

 

How Does The L.R.S. OF-Garches T-Clamp Work

The L.R.S. OF-Garches T-Clamp functions through a well-engineered design. The user first positions the clamp around the object or materials that need to be held. The T-shaped base provides stability and support.

The clamping mechanism is activated, usually by turning a screw or lever. This action causes the jaws of the clamp to close in on the workpiece. The jaws are designed to distribute pressure evenly to ensure a firm grip. As the force is applied, the T-design helps resist any twisting or tipping that might occur.

The clamp can be adjusted to different widths and angles to accommodate various shapes and sizes of objects. Once the desired clamping force is achieved, it holds the workpiece securely in place until the task, such as gluing, welding, or machining, is completed. The reliable construction and design make it an effective tool for a wide range of applications.
